A group of academics from the University of California and Tsinghua University has uncovered a series of critical security flaws that could lead to a revival of DNS cache poisoning attacks. Dubbed " SAD DNS attack " (short for Side-channel AttackeD DNS), the technique makes it possible for a malicious actor to carry out an off-path attack, rerouting any traffic originally destined to a specific domain to a server under their control, thereby allowing them to eavesdrop and tamper with the communications. "This represents an important milestone — the first weaponizable network side channel attack that has serious security impacts," the researchers said. "The attack allows an off-path attacker to inject a malicious DNS record into a DNS cache." Tracked as CVE-2020-25705, the findings were presented at the ACM Conference on Computer, and Communications Security (CCS '20) held this week. A phishing-as-a-service (PhaaS) platform known as  Robin Banks  has relocated its attack infrastructure to DDoS-Guard, a Russian provider of bulletproof hosting services. The switch comes after "Cloudflare disassociated Robin Banks phishing infrastructure from its services, causing a multi-day disruption to operations," according to a  report  from cybersecurity company IronNet. Robin Banks was  first documented  in July 2022 when the platform's abilities to offer ready-made phishing kits to criminal actors were revealed, making it possible to steal the financial information of customers of popular banks and other online services. It was also found to prompt users to enter Google and Microsoft credentials on rogue landing pages, suggesting an attempt on part of the malware authors to monetize initial access to corporate networks for post-exploitation activities such as espionage and ransomware. Several distributed denial-of-service (DDoS) botnets have been observed exploiting a critical flaw in Zyxel devices that came to light in April 2023 to gain remote control of vulnerable systems. "Through the capture of exploit traffic, the attacker's IP address was identified, and it was determined that the attacks were occurring in multiple regions, including Central America, North America, East Asia, and South Asia," Fortinet FortiGuard Labs researcher Cara Lin  said . The flaw, tracked as CVE-2023-28771 (CVSS score: 9.8), is a command injection bug affecting multiple firewall models that could potentially allow an unauthorized actor to execute arbitrary code by sending a specifically crafted packet to the targeted appliance. Last month, the Shadowserver Foundation  warned  that the flaw was being "actively exploited to build a Mirai-like botnet" at least since May 26, 2023, an indication of how abuse of  servers running unpatched software  is on the rise.

It seems like the prolonged downtime and technical difficulties faced by The Pirate Bay over the past several weeks were due to a series of distributed denial of service (DDoS) attacks against the widely-popular torrent website by malicious actors. For those unaware, The Pirate Bay was down for more than a week with most visitors displayed a Cloudflare error mentioning that a "bad gateway" is causing problems, while others served with a "database maintenance" message prompting users to check back in 10 minutes. Though the site's moderators did not reveal any details regarding the Pirate Bay downtime, a reputable source with a direct link with the operators told Torrent Freak that the recent Pirate Bay downtime issues "were likely caused by malicious actors who DDoSed the site's search engine with specially crafted search queries." Vulnerable routers from MikroTik have been misused to form what cybersecurity researchers have called one of the largest botnet-as-a-service cybercrime operations seen in recent years.  According to a new piece of research published by Avast, a cryptocurrency mining campaign leveraging the new-disrupted  Glupteba botnet  as well as the infamous TrickBot malware were all distributed using the same command-and-control (C2) server. "The C2 server serves as a botnet-as-a-service controlling nearly 230,000 vulnerable MikroTik routers," Avast's senior malware researcher, Martin Hron,  said  in a write-up, potentially linking it to what's now called the Mēris botnet. The botnet is known to exploit a known vulnerability in the Winbox component of MikroTik routers ( CVE-2018-14847 ), enabling the attackers to gain unauthenticated, remote administrative access to any affected device. Google on Tuesday said it took steps to disrupt the operations of a sophisticated "multi-component" botnet called Glupteba that approximately infected more than one million Windows computers across the globe and stored its command-and-control server addresses on Bitcoin's blockchain as a resilience mechanism. As part of the efforts, Google's Threat Analysis Group (TAG) said it partnered with the CyberCrime Investigation Group over the past year to terminate around 63 million Google Docs that were observed to have distributed the malware, alongside 1,183 Google Accounts, 908 Cloud Projects, and 870 Google Ads accounts that were associated with its distribution. Google TAG further said it worked with internet infrastructure providers and hosting providers, such as Cloudflare, to dismantle the malware by taking down servers and placing interstitial warning pages in front of the malicious domains. The threat actor known as  ChamelGang  has been observed using a previously undocumented implant to backdoor Linux systems, marking a new expansion of the threat actor's capabilities. The malware, dubbed  ChamelDoH  by Stairwell, is a C++-based tool for communicating via DNS-over-HTTPS ( DoH ) tunneling. ChamelGang was  first outed  by Russian cybersecurity firm Positive Technologies in September 2021, detailing its attacks on fuel, energy, and aviation production industries in Russia, the U.S., India, Nepal, Taiwan, and Japan. Attack chains mounted by the actor have leveraged vulnerabilities in Microsoft Exchange servers and Red Hat JBoss Enterprise Application to gain initial access and carry out data theft attacks using a passive backdoor called DoorMe. "This is a native  IIS module  that is registered as a filter through which HTTP requests and responses are processed," Positive Technologies said at the time. DDoS attackers attempted to bring down an Banking services earlier this week using one of the largest Distributed denial of service attack using DNS reflection technique. Prolexic, the global leader in Distributed Denial of Service (DDoS) protection services, announced  that it has successfully mitigated the largest DNS reflection attack ever recorded, which peaked at 167 Gigabits per second (Gbps). The company did not name the target of the digital assault. DNS-reflection was the attack method used in Operation Stophaus , an attack waged in March by The Spamhaus Project, a Geneva-based not-for-profit organization dedicated to fighting Internet spam . When Spamhaus was assaulted by a vast 300Gbps peak DNS reflection attack, it engaged the help of a content delivery network (CDN) called CloudFlare to help defend itself. The malware loader known as PikaBot is being distributed as part of a  malvertising   campaign  targeting users searching for legitimate software like AnyDesk. "PikaBot was previously only distributed via malspam campaigns similarly to QakBot and emerged as one of the preferred payloads for a threat actor known as TA577," Malwarebytes' Jérôme Segura  said . The malware family, which  first   appeared  in early 2023, consists of a loader and a core module that allows it to operate as a backdoor as well as a distributor for other payloads. This  enables  the threat actors to gain unauthorized remote access to compromised systems and transmit commands from a command-and-control (C2) server, ranging from arbitrary shellcode, DLLs, or executable files, to other malicious tools such as Cobalt Strike. Google has announced plans to add support for quantum-resistant encryption algorithms in its Chrome browser, starting with version 116. "Chrome will begin supporting  X25519Kyber768  for establishing symmetric secrets in  TLS , starting in Chrome 116, and available behind a flag in Chrome 115," Devon O'Brien  said  in a post published Thursday. Kyber was  chosen  by the U.S. Department of Commerce's National Institute of Standards and Technology (NIST) as the candidate for general encryption in a bid to tackle future cyber attacks posed by the advent of quantum computing.  Kyber-768  is roughly the security equivalent of  AES-192 . The encryption algorithm has already been adopted by  Cloudflare ,  Amazon Web Services , and IBM. X25519Kyber768 is a hybrid algorithm that combines the output of  X25519 , an elliptic curve algorithm widely used for key agreement in TLS, and Kyber-768 to create a strong session key to encrypt TLS connections. Matrix—the organization behind an open source project that offers a protocol for secure and decentralized real-time communication—has suffered a massive cyber attack after unknown attackers gained access to the servers hosting its official website and data. Hackers defaced Matrix's website, and also stole unencrypted private messages, password hashes, access tokens, as well as GPG keys the project maintainers used for signing packages. The cyber attack eventually forced the organization to shut down its entire production infrastructure for several hours and log all users out of Matrix.org. So, if you have an account with Matrix.org service and do not have backups of your encryption keys or were not using server-side encryption key backup, unfortunately, you will not be able to read your entire encrypted conversation history. The U.S. National Security Agency (NSA) on Friday said DNS over HTTPS (DoH) — if configured appropriately in enterprise environments — can help prevent "numerous" initial access, command-and-control, and exfiltration techniques used by threat actors. "DNS over Hypertext Transfer Protocol over Transport Layer Security (HTTPS), often referred to as DNS over HTTPS (DoH), encrypts DNS requests by using HTTPS to provide privacy, integrity, and 'last mile' source authentication with a client's DNS resolver," according to the NSA's  new guidance . Proposed in 2018,  DoH  is a protocol for performing remote Domain Name System resolution via the HTTPS protocol. One of the major shortcomings with current DNS lookups is that even when someone visits a site that uses HTTPS, the DNS query and its response is sent over an unencrypted connection, thus allowing third-party eavesdropping on the network to track every website a user is visiting.
